    Coming from a 07 WRX with the factory short shifter my new 6spd is a different ball game. To me it feels clunky and the shifts are long. hopefully a short shifter will alleviate that. I also find myself skipping gears(mostly 3rd & 5th) a lot and averaging 17.5-18.5mpg
